Missouri Facts
The most powerful earthquake to strike the United States occurred in 1811, centered in New Madrid, Missouri. The quake shook more than one million square miles, and was felt as far as 1,000 miles away.
The tallest man in documented medical history was Robert Pershing Wadlow from St. Louis, Missouri. He was 8 feet, 11.1 inches tall.
At the St. Louis World's Fair in 1904, Richard Blechyden served tea with ice and invented iced tea.
